ATLANTA - A federal judge on Monday permanently blocked Georgia’s 2019 “heartbeat” abortion law, finding that it violates the U.S. Constitution. U.S. District Judge Steve Jones ruled against the state in a lawsuit filed by abortion providers and an advocacy group. Jones had temporarily blocked the law in October, and it never went into effect. The new ruling permanently enjoins the state from ever enforcing House Bill 481. Black students in New York state are 44 percent more likely than white students to have a teacher rated “ineffective” in math, and 35 percent more likely to have one rated “ineffective” in English, startling new figures from the state Education Department show. The unprecedented analysis stemmed from the results of the statewide teacher-evaluation system, which for the first time required student performance on standardized exams to factor into teachers’ ratings.

Detroit, a once great city, has become an urban vacuum. Its population has fallen to around 700,000 from nearly 1.9 million in 1950. The city is estimated to have more than 70,000 abandoned buildings and 90,000 vacant lots.
